Real Madrid could re-ignite interest in Chelsea star following injury comeback (Details)

Real Madrid continues to search for a new long-term right-back, considering the age of their current options, Dani Carvajal and Lucas Vazquez, both 32 years old.

Chelsea’s Reece James has been linked with Real Madrid as a potential candidate for the position. At 24 years old, he could provide a long-term solution for the club.

James recently returned from a five-month injury layoff and made an impact, providing an assist in Chelsea’s win over Nottingham Forest.

Real Madrid has reportedly admired James for a while but is unlikely to make a move this summer, as right-back isn’t a top priority. However, if James can stay fit and perform well over the next year, Real Madrid may consider a move in 2025.

Despite concerns about his injury record, James could be an excellent addition for Real Madrid and potentially their best option at right-back if he can stay healthy. His performance will likely determine the club’s interest in pursuing him in the future.
